Skoda Auto (India) reported 5,152 units of domestic wholesales in April 2022, an increase of 436 when compared to a low base of 961 units registered in April last year. April's sales performance is the second highest number of units sold in a month ever, after March 2022 when the company recorded 5608 units. The company attributed the consistent sales numbers to its increasing network expansion, increased customer touchpoints.
Zac Hollis, Brand Director, Skoda Auto India, said, “The Slavia is a resounding success while the Kushaq SUV continues finding newer homes. We have already crossed 190+ touch points so far and will only expand further. This ‘Beyond the Product’ approach is seeing us record consistent sales month on month.”
